#bde170 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bde170 is composed of 74.1% red, 88.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 79.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 66.1%. #bde170 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e0 with #7bc300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#bde170 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bde170 has RGB values of R:189, G:225,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 12444016.

Hex triplet bde170 #bde170
RGB Decimal 189, 225, 112 rgb(189,225,112)
RGB Percent 74.1, 88.2, 43.9 rgb(74.1%,88.2%,43.9%)
CMYK 16, 0, 50, 12
HSL 79.1°, 65.3, 66.1 hsl(79.1,65.3%,66.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 79.1°, 50.2, 88.2
Web Safe cccc66 #cccc66
CIE-LAB 84.914, -29.112, 50.939
XYZ 50.835, 65.839, 25.358
xyY 0.358, 0.464, 65.839
CIE-LCH 84.914, 58.671, 119.748
CIE-LUV 84.914, -16.986, 69.92
Hunter-Lab 81.141, -30.166, 38.269
Binary 10111101, 11100001, 01110000

Shades and Tints of #bde170

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f2 is the lightest one.
